1. Introduction
Thank you for choosing the INJUSA Kawasaki Ninja ZX10 12V Electric Motorcycle. This manual provides essential information for the safe assembly, operation, and maintenance of your new ride-on toy. Please read it thoroughly before use and retain it for future reference.
The INJUSA Kawasaki Ninja ZX10 is a 12V battery-powered electric motorcycle, officially licensed, and recommended for children aged 3 years and older. It features an ergonomic design with stabilizer wheels and acceleration controlled by the right handlebar grip. The motorcycle reaches a maximum speed of 6 km/h and includes an MP3 input for music playback. It comes with a 12V battery and charger, and is manufactured in Spain, complying with EU safety standards.

4. Configuration et assemblage
Assembly is required for this product. Please follow these steps carefully. A Phillips head screwdriver and wrench (not included) may be needed.
- Fixez la roue avant :
Align the front wheel with the fork. Insert the axle through the fork and wheel. Secure with the provided washers and nuts on both sides. Ensure the wheel spins freely but has no excessive wobble.
Image : détaillée view of the front wheel and fork assembly.
- Install Stabilizer Wheels:
Locate the mounting points at the rear of the motorcycle. Attach each stabilizer wheel arm to its respective side using the provided screws and nuts. Ensure they are securely fastened and provide stable support.
Image : détaillée view of a rear stabilizer wheel and the faux exhaust.
- Connectez la batterie :
Locate the battery compartment, usually under the seat. Connect the battery terminals (red to red, black to black). Ensure connections are firm. Close the battery compartment securely. - Charge initiale:
Before first use, fully charge the 12V battery for 8-12 hours. Refer to the 'Charging the Battery' section for details.

5.2. Démarrage et conduite
- Mettez l'interrupteur d'alimentation sur la position « ON ».
- To move forward, twist the right handlebar grip. Release the grip to stop.
- The motorcycle has a maximum speed of 6 km/h.
- Average battery life per charge is approximately 60 minutes, depending on usage and terrain.
